Songs for a New World sits on the boundary between musical and song cycle: it is a series of largely disjoint songs with (unlike a musical) no plot or characters that continue from song to song. Instead, the theme is the moment of decision, the point at which you transition from the old to the new. The show takes the audience from the deck of a 1492 Spanish sailing ship to a ledge 57 stories above Fifth Avenue to meet an array of characters ranging from a three men lamenting their problems with the women they love to a woman whose dream of marrying rich nabs her the man of her dreams and a soulless marriage.
